[QUOTE="allfarewells, post: 6517578, member: 1004296"] that’s always going to be a tough one … I suppose it depends entirely if you are showing traits of an addiction…. Do you borrow money to gamble….? Do you gamble till you have nothing left? Do you consistently lose? …. Or do you have a bankroll structure? Do you consistently sustain your wanted lifestyle from gambling? Do you gamble debt free? Are you able to play and walk away even? Do you have a happy medium with life and gambling? Does family come first? I’m no expert I. Don’t claim to be but if your doing gambling as a job and you live a good life I wouldn’t say you have any issues atall as long as your not chasing losses but if your gamble to excess and are losing more than winning and relying on others to fund your habit I’d seek help and this is for anyone ….. but I pass no judgments as to how anyone lives their life’s I wish you all nothing but success and happiness 🙏 God bless you all ❤️ [/QUOTE]
